Transaction 95ef61430659b94833d7c521394f40f3994adba464819e39fd820cb2f9864412

1 Input
2 Outputs
  • 95ef61430659b94833d7c521394f40f3994adba464819e39fd820cb2f9864412:0
  • value  1685034
    address  1DHNvF87yz8FFtuyKoKnuVaQiV7aBJ1PxS
  • 95ef61430659b94833d7c521394f40f3994adba464819e39fd820cb2f9864412:1
  • value  1904888
    address  1BK6tRBxYiKzpV7Hqb7JVpKMze6DorPVhK